4.1. Dimensions
4. Technical data
Floor saw
Machine description: Floor saw Floor saw
Machine type: KDF-800E KDF-700E
Machine-No.:
Power: 7,5 kW 7,5 kW
Engine type: 400V-50Hz-16A 400V-50Hz-16A
Speed at the primary shaft: 1350 u/min 1500 u/min
Weight (without blade guard): 135kg / 297,6lbs 135kg / 297,6lbs
Blade diameter: max. 800mm max. 700mm
Cutting depth: max. 340mm max. 290mm
Weight blade guard 15kg / 33lbs 15kg / 33lbs
Sound pressure level at wor-
king area
86dB(A) 86dB(A)
Sound level 105dB(A) 105dB(A)

6.1 Removing the electric motor
at the manual.
Floor saw
Disconnect the connector of the belt guard by pulling it vertically up-
wards together with the cover cover. (A)
Loosen the nut on the threaded rod, which connects the console
plate to the low feed. Now pull the threaded rod back out of the fran-
king. (B)
Tilt the motor with the console plate as far as it is possible. You
should now be able to pull the drive belt from the belt pulley towards
you. (C)
Lift the motor and the console plate out of the machine. (D)
The motor is installed in reverse order. (E)

7. Connection and Assembly
7.1 Connection of water hoses and cables
The cool water connection is done with a „Gardena“ connection.
Use clean water only!
For the electric connection you need a 16A CCE cable (min 5x2mm² /
cable length 25m). Please make sure that all three phases are pre-
sent.
